The countless flakes that shiver down the trail between dark pines, are thick as history’s greatest tickertape parade on Broadway. Hear the roar of crowds in boughs, applauding hands in trees’ remotest high recesses, as wind swoops smoking, glittering snow in honor of the hero of the moment, in the long procession of snowbird, mouse, and solo wren. Robert Morgan

Robert Morgan was the featured author of our Summer 2004 issue and has written twenty-two pieces with us over twenty-five years. Two of his stories were published in Appalachian Heritage before his first story collection appeared. A native of Western North Carolina and a Cornell professor, he has published sixteen poetry collections, three short story collections, five novels, and two non-fiction books. The American Academy of Arts and Letters presented their highest award to him in 2007.
